What is Cryptocurrency?

Cryptocurrency is a form of digital or virtual currency that uses cryptography for security. Unlike traditional money issued by a central authority like a government or bank, cryptocurrencies operate on decentralized networks called blockchains. The most well-known cryptocurrency is Bitcoin, but there are thousands of others, each with its own unique features and uses.

The Risks of Cryptocurrency

While there are many benefits to cryptocurrency, it’s important to be aware of the risks involved. One major risk is the volatility of the market. Cryptocurrency prices can be highly unpredictable, with significant price fluctuations occurring within short periods of time. This volatility can result in substantial gains but also substantial losses.

Another risk is the potential for scams and fraud. The cryptocurrency market has attracted its fair share of bad actors looking to take advantage of unsuspecting individuals. It’s crucial to do thorough research and only use reputable exchanges and wallets to ensure the security of your funds.

Getting Started with Cryptocurrency

If you’re ready to dip your toes into the world of cryptocurrency, here are some steps to get you started:

  1. Educate Yourself: Take the time to learn about different cryptocurrencies, blockchain technology, and how to securely store your digital assets.
  2. Choose an Exchange: Select a reputable cryptocurrency exchange where you can buy and sell cryptocurrencies.
  3. Create a Wallet: Set up a digital wallet to store your cryptocurrencies securely. There are various types of wallets, including hardware wallets, software wallets, and online wallets.
  4. Start Small: It’s advisable to start with a small investment and gradually increase your exposure to cryptocurrencies as you become more comfortable with the market.
  5. Stay Informed: Keep up-to-date with the latest news and developments in the cryptocurrency space to make informed investment decisions.
